Output 5f8e9039b0e413c2efc61d7f52eabc265b472d575a800e0e7c667e18cc5859ea:0

value
2690319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2898aa5834f36dddde18cfe486e8d4462a641e84 OP_EQUALVERIFY OP_CHECKSIG
address
14hev416tRcemnDxaavSNav4nQ6Q7EiBPs
transaction
5f8e9039b0e413c2efc61d7f52eabc265b472d575a800e0e7c667e18cc5859ea